+=head1 NAME
+
+paymentech-download
+
+paymentech-download - Retrieve payment batch responses from Chase Paymentech.
+
+=head1 SYNOPSIS
+
+ paymentech-download [ -v ] [ -t ] user
+
+=head1 DESCRIPTION
+
+Command line tool to download payment batch responses from the Chase Paymentech
+gateway. These are XML files packaged in ZIP files. This script downloads them
+by SFTP, extracts the contents, and passes them to L<FS::pay_batch::import_result>.
+
+-v: Be verbose.
+
+-t: Use the test server.
+
+user: freeside username

+=head1 NAME
+
+paymentech-upload
+
+paymentech-upload - Transmit a payment batch to Chase Paymentech via SFTP.
+
+=head1 SYNOPSIS
+
+ paymentech-upload [ -v ] [ -t ] user batchnum
+
+=head1 DESCRIPTION
+
+Command line tool to upload a payment batch to the Chase Paymentech gateway.
+The batch will be exported to the Paymentech XML format, packaged in a ZIP
+file, and transmitted via SFTP. Use L<paymentech-download> to retrieve the
+response file.
+
+-v: Be verbose.
+
+-t: Send the transaction to the test server.
+
+user: freeside username
+
+batchnum: pay_batch primary key
+
+=head1 BUGS
+
+Passing the zip password on the command line is slightly risky.
